Zane Trace won the last time they faced Piketon, and things went their way on Tuesday too. Everything went the Zane Trace Pioneers' way against the Piketon Redstreaks as the Zane Trace Pioneers made off with a 3-0 win.
While Zane Trace won a shutout, things came down to the wire in the third set they played. The match finished with set scores of 25-18, 25-20, 25-23.
Leading Zane Trace to victory were Kerrigan Hill and Reise Grant. Hill had 15 digs, while Grant had six digs.
Zane Trace now has a winning record of 10-9. As for Piketon, they are on a four-game losing streak that has dropped them down to 5-12.
